Topical administration of tacrolimus and corticosteroids with concentration gradients is effective in preventing immune rejection in high-risk keratoplasty: a 5-year follow-up study

Abstract: BACKGROUND: To evaluate the efficacy of topical administration of immunosuppressants and corticosteroids with concentration gradients in the management of patients with high-risk keratoplasty.METHODS: One hundred and six patients treated with topical immunosuppressants (50 eyes in FK506 group and 56 eyes in CsA group) and corticosteroids eye drops with concentration gradients were enrolled in the study.
